WebMethicillin-resistant Staphylococcus aureus (MRSA) is a type of staph that has changed (become resistant) due to overuse and abuse of antibiotics. Antibiotics are drugs that kill bacteria. This resistant staph can’t be killed by the usual antibiotics, like penicillin and methicillin. Certain other antibiotics will still kill MRSA. WebAntibiotic resistance is often linked to a specific germ and antibiotic. For example, Staphylococcus aureus (or “staph”) is a type of bacteria that can cause illness. Methicillin-resistant S. aureus (MRSA) is a specific strain of staph bacteria. MRSA no longer responds to the antibiotic methicillin (and closely related medicines).
